The problem behind this research is the way students learn who tend to only read and memorize textbooks. The teaching materials used by schools only rely on textbooks. This study aims to produce SAS based on problem-solving in the digestive system material in humans that is valid and practical. The SAS was validated by lecturers in the biology department of FMIPA UNP and biology teacher at SMAN 1 Panyabungan Selatan. The practicality of this product was carried out by one biology teacher and fifty students at SMAN 1 Panyabungan Selatan. As a result, problem-solving-based worksheets were developed using 3 stages of the 4D model, namely the define stage by analyzing learning needs using the curriculum, the design stage by Designing SAS components, and the Develop stage which aims to produce valid and practical SAS. The value of validity is 92.02% with very valid criteria, practicality by teachers is 90.38% with the criteria is very feasible and students are 89.28% with very feasible criteria. Based on this study, it can be concluded that Student Activity Sheets (SAS) based on problem-solving have been produced on the material of digestive system in humans in class XI of SMAN 1 Panyabungan Selatan which are valid and practical.
